Skip to content

Capabilities 2025 chapter#4355

Merged
tunetheweb merged 16 commits intomainfrom
capabilities-2025-chapter
Jan 21, 2026
Merged

Capabilities 2025 chapter#4355
tunetheweb merged 16 commits intomainfrom
capabilities-2025-chapter

Conversation

@tunetheweb
Copy link
Copy Markdown
Member

@tunetheweb tunetheweb commented Jan 14, 2026

Closes #4065

Staged version: https://capabilities-2025-dot-webalmanac.uk.r.appspot.com/en/2025/capabilities
Staged featured quotes: https://capabilities-2025-dot-webalmanac.uk.r.appspot.com/en/2025/?feat=capabilities#featured-chapter

Still to do:

  • - Finish chapter
  • - Confirm team
  • - Add @Dawntraoz bio
  • - Add quotes
  • - Add any new figure images
  • - Address TODOs in markdown

@tunetheweb tunetheweb marked this pull request as draft January 14, 2026 08:13
@github-actions
Copy link
Copy Markdown
Contributor

Images automagically compressed by Calibre's image-actions

Compression reduced images by 26.6%, saving 32.3 KB.

Filename Before After Improvement Visual comparison
src/static/images/2025/capabilities/device-memory.png 17.3 KB 12.4 KB 28.1% View diff
src/static/images/2025/capabilities/add-to-home-screen.png 17.0 KB 12.2 KB 28.2% View diff
src/static/images/2025/capabilities/web-share.png 17.2 KB 12.4 KB 27.6% View diff
src/static/images/2025/capabilities/compression-streams.png 18.3 KB 13.7 KB 25.5% View diff
src/static/images/2025/capabilities/media-session.png 17.5 KB 12.9 KB 26.3% View diff
src/static/images/2025/capabilities/clipboard.png 17.8 KB 13.5 KB 24.4% View diff
src/static/images/2025/capabilities/media-capabilities.png 16.4 KB 12.1 KB 26.2% View diff

@tunetheweb tunetheweb added the writing Related to wording and content label Jan 14, 2026
@tunetheweb tunetheweb closed this Jan 15, 2026
@Dawntraoz Dawntraoz reopened this Jan 19, 2026
@Dawntraoz
Copy link
Copy Markdown
Contributor

I'm sorry for being late, timing was really bad, but I've managed to finish the chapter's content today!

I added what was missing in the markdown and the requested metadata. The only thing missing is a table, I think I need some guidance is how to add a table as a figure for the built-in AI APIs section, like in this draft, which is also a table at the fugu tab in the Google Sheets.

With that and your feedback @tunetheweb & @guaca I think we are good to go 🥹

Copy link
Copy Markdown
Member Author

@tunetheweb tunetheweb left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I've added the table and made some other edits in 34afb89.

I've also restaged the chapter at: https://capabilities-2025-dot-webalmanac.uk.r.appspot.com/en/2025/capabilities

Looks good to me minus a couple of comments.

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
console.log(text); // "Hello from Web Almanac!"
```

Supported in Chromium-based browsers and Safari. Firefox has partial support.
Copy link
Copy Markdown
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Can you explain more about what's partial about Firefox's support? I was curious and went looking on MDN (https://developer.mozilla.org/en-US/docs/Web/API/Clipboard_API#browser_compatibility) but couldn't see anything it didn't support that Safari did?

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

+1, I also stumbled upon this. A big cross-browser support gap is Web-custom formats.

Copy link
Copy Markdown
Contributor

@Dawntraoz Dawntraoz Jan 20,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I added this clarification: "The Async Clibpoard API is supported in Chromium-based browsers, Safari and Firefox. Only Chromium-based browsers have support for richer clipboard data, like web custom formats."

Since indeed, I think I overlook Safari support for the ClipboardItem. Thanks for spotting it!

@tunetheweb tunetheweb marked this pull request as ready for review January 20, 2026 00:10
@tunetheweb tunetheweb requested a review from guaca January 20, 2026 00:10
@tomayac tomayac self-requested a review January 20, 2026 08:52
Copy link
Copy Markdown
Member

@tomayac tomayac left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Mostly LGTM, with a few factual corrections or refinements.

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Comment thread src/content/en/2025/capabilities.md Outdated
Dawntraoz and others added 2 commits January 20, 2026 19:39
Co-authored-by: Barry Pollard <barrypollard@google.com>
Co-authored-by: Thomas Steiner <steiner.thomas@gmail.com>
@Dawntraoz
Copy link
Copy Markdown
Contributor

Thanks a lot for the review and edition, plus the table generation 😍, @tunetheweb & @tomayac!

On my way to clarify the two comments you left apart from the editions/reviews, and we will be good to go 🤩

Copy link
Copy Markdown
Member Author

@tunetheweb tunetheweb left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Think this is good to merge from my side. Shout now or will merge and release tomorrow!

Copy link
Copy Markdown
Member

@guaca guaca left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Great job! 🚀

Copy link
Copy Markdown
Member

@tomayac tomayac left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M from my side as well.

@tunetheweb tunetheweb merged commit 6bb6cf2 into main Jan 21, 2026
10 checks passed
@tunetheweb tunetheweb deleted the capabilities-2025-chapter branch January 21, 2026 09:13
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

writing Related to wording and content

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Capabilities 2025

5 participants